Final Call for Applications to International MFA Program

Application deadline: June 1, 2009

TRANSART INSTITUTE seeks independent, inquisitive and imaginative
artist for its MFA program. In a uniquely international setting
Transart Institute offers an accredited two year low-residency course
for working artists, teachers and all professionals in related fields
who are seeking advancement in visual arts and new media. The program
consists of three intensive summer residencies in Europe filled with
lectures, workshops, critiques, seminars, performances and exhibitions
and two shorter, optional winter residencies in New York. In the four
semesters between residencies, students create an individual course of
study realizing art and research projects with the support of faculty
and self-chosen artist mentors wherever they work and live.

The Transart MFA program is geared towards the development of a
sustainable artistic praxis rather than training in certain media or
genres, challenging students to think conceptually and work creatively
in new ways. Current students work with animation, curating, digital
media, film, gaming, graphic design, installation, painting,
performance, photography, robotics, sculpture, sound, text, video,
virtual reality.

STUDENTS

The majority of Transart students are emerging and mid-career artists
and teachers at tertiary institutions. Transart Institute's
residencies are a true meeting place for cultural exchange. Current
students will converge for the summer residency from areas as diverse
as Puerto Rico, Pakistan, Iceland, Croatia, Ethiopia, Canada, Costa
Rica, Germany, Austria, Egypt, the Netherlands, the Philippines, the
UK and the US.

FACULTY

Transart faculty comes from a wide range of academic and artistic
backgrounds as well as geographic locations. Current theoretical areas
of expertise include software art, curatorial work, cyberfeminism,
interface technologies, born-digital arts, continental philosophy,
media, conflict and peace studies, social studies in colonialism,
capitalism and tourism, and contemporary asian art history. Studio
faculty include international artists working with sound, performance,
dance and choreography, photography, drawing, sculpture, clothing
design, film and video, intervention and installation art.
